Stanley Frank Topolewski 1943 - 2010

Stanley Frank Topolewski of Pinckney, Livingston County, MI was born on April 8, 1943, and died at age 67 years old on November 3, 2010. Stanley Topolewski was buried at Great Lakes National Cemetery Section 3 Site 213 4200 Belford Road, in Holly.

In 1943, in the year that Stanley Frank Topolewski was born, on June 20th through June 22nd, the Detroit Race Riot erupted at Belle Isle Park. The rioting spread throughout the city (made worse by false rumors of attacks on blacks and whites) and resulted in the deployment of 6,000 Federal troops. 34 people were killed, (25 of them black) - mostly by white police or National Guardsmen, 433 were wounded (75 percent of them black) and an estimated $2 million of property was destroyed. The same summer, there were riots in Beaumont, Texas and Harlem, New York.
